Rupee ends flat at 95.95 as RBI dollar sales offset pressure
On Wednesday, the Indian rupee maintained its position at 95.95 against the US dollar, thanks to the central bank's dollar sales which helped stabilize its value. However, ongoing demand from oil firms and importers kept the currency under strain. Market analysts predict further depreciation, especially if the US Federal Reserve opts for interest rate increases, with trading expected between 95.75 and 96.25 on Thursday.
